Here’s our family recipe for a hot chocolate mix you can keep in your pantry for a chilly day.
Dairy Free Hot Chocolate Mix Recipe
2 cups powdered sugar
1/2 cup cocoa
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oons cornstarch
Coconut milk, oat milk, soy milk or rice milk (your favorite milk alternative)
Optional: Marshmallows or non-dairy whip cream (like Soyatoo Whip)
Directions: Sift powdered sugar, cocoa, salt and cornstarch together. Transfer to an airtight container for storage. To make hot cocoa, heat 1 cup non-dairy milk in the microwave or on the stove to desired heat (We usually heat ours 1 minute in the microwave but always test to be sure it is not too hot for little ones). Stir 3 Tablespoons of mix into heated milk alternative until well mixed. Top with marshmallows or non-dairy whip if desired.
